Rephonic is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server. Research 3M+ podcasts with audience data, contacts, episodes, transcripts, charts, and sponsors. Install with: Remote MCP: https://mcp.rephonic.com. Source: https://github.com/getrephonic/rephonic-mcp. It speaks the Model Context Protocol and works with any compatible client (Claude, Cursor, Cline, Windsurf, Warp and more).
